[First Look] Hulu’s Anthology Horror Series “Into the Dark” Premieres October 5th

Published

on

Pictured: Hulu's "Into the Dark" Episode 1: 'THE BODY' directed by Paul Davis

Bloody Disgusting learned today that Hulu will launch the Blumhouse-produced 12-part anthology series “Into the Dark” on October 5, 2018, with a new episode airing each month for an entire year. We have details on the first two episodes, with the first being directed by Paul Davis, the filmmaker behind Beware the Moon: Remembering ‘An American Werewolf in London’.

In “The Body”, pictured above, penned by Davis and Paul Fischer, “A sophisticated hitman with a cynical view on modern society finds his work made more difficult when he has to transport a body on Halloween night, but everyone is enamored by what they think is his killer costume.

The episode stars Tom Bateman, Rebecca Rittenhouse, David Hull, Aurora Perrineau and “Ash vs Evil Dead’s” Ray Santiago.


The second episode, “Flesh & Blood”, will premiere on November 2, 2018.

Directed by Drive Angry and My Bloody Valentine‘s Patrick Lussier, “Kimberly, a teenager suffering from agoraphobia, has not left the house since her mother’s murder, which remains unsolved. While under the care of her doting father on the eve of Thanksgiving, Kimberly begins to suspect that she is in danger, and that it’s always the ones you love that hurt you the most.

Dermot Mulroney, Diana Silvers, Tembi Locke and Meredith Salenger. It was penned by Louis Ackerman.

“Agatha All Along” Brings Darkness to Disney+ This September

Published

on

Kathryn Hahn is back as the bewitching villain Agatha Harkness in the upcoming Disney+ series “Agatha All Along, confirmed as the official title of the upcoming series tonight.

“Agatha All Along” premieres with the first TWO episodes on September 18.

You can watch the title reveal video below, which makes it clear that all the previous titles for the series were part of a clever marketing campaign… all along. Well played, Marvel.

Tony-winner Patti LuPone joins the previously announced Aubrey Plaza (Child’s Play) and Joe Locke (Heartstopper), as well as Ali Ahn, Maria Dizzia, and Sasheer Zamata.

Emma Caulfield Ford (“Wandavision”) will also be back as the character Dottie.

Jac Schaeffer (“WandaVision”) is on board the series as writer/exec producer.

Plot details for the spinoff project are under wraps at the moment, so it’s unclear if the series will pick up following the events of “WandaVision.” In the finale’s big final battle, Wanda of course defeated Agatha Harkness, trapping her in the town of Westview.

One of Earth’s most powerful witches, we knew she’d eventually be back…
